{1+8+27+64+125...} find the next 9 terms
Bogdan [553]

Answer: 216, 343, 512, 729, 1000, 1331, 1728, 2197, 2744

Step-by-step explanation: The terms are the cubes of the numbers 1, 2, 3, 4, 5...

Estimate the answer to 44,596,251 – 28,257,934 by first rounding each number to the nearest million. 
pickupchik [31]
<span>Estimate
</span>44,596,251 = <span>45,000,000
</span>28,257,934 = <span>28,000,000

</span>45,000,000 - 28,000,000 = 17,000,000

answer
17,000,000
